A panel of experts in infectious disease and managed care to discuss management of HIV, including the need for individualized care and the role for newer treatments options.
At the beginning of the year, The American Journal of Managed Care® convened a panel of experts in infectious disease and managed care to discuss management of HIV, including the need for individualized care and the role for newer treatments options. Here, we provide some of that conversation.
